Structure and Working Principle
A modular anemometer tower consists of multiple sections that can be stacked or connected to achieve the desired height. Each section is typically bolted or clamped together, ensuring stability and ease of assembly. The tower is anchored to the ground using guy wires or a solid foundation, depending on the installation site and environmental conditions. At the top of the tower, anemometers and wind vanes are mounted to measure wind speed and direction. These sensors are connected to data loggers or telemetry systems that record and transmit the collected data. The modular design allows for the addition of other sensors, such as temperature, humidity, or pressure gauges, depending on the specific requirements of the project.

Application Areas
Modular anemometer towers are widely used in the wind energy industry for site assessment and turbine performance monitoring. Accurate wind data is critical for determining the feasibility of a wind farm and optimizing turbine placement. These towers are also used in meteorological stations to provide real-time wind data for weather forecasting and climate research. In addition to energy and meteorology, modular anemometer towers are employed in aviation for wind shear detection and in environmental monitoring to assess air quality and dispersion patterns. Their versatility and reliability make them indispensable tools in these fields.
Maintenance and Precautions
Regular maintenance is essential to ensure the longevity and accuracy of a modular anemometer tower. Inspections should be conducted periodically to check for signs of corrosion, loose bolts, or damaged sensors. Cleaning the sensors and ensuring proper grounding are also important for reliable data collection. Precautions should be taken during installation to secure the tower against high winds and other environmental stresses. Proper anchoring and guy wire tensioning are critical to prevent tower collapse. Additionally, safety measures should be followed during assembly and disassembly to prevent accidents.
